Hubbard" Sender: owner-freebsd-hackers@FreeBSD.ORG X-Loop: FreeBSD.org Precedence: bulk > another thing... the cvsup tag RELENG_2_2_5 seems to retreive -current. i > was running 2.2-STABLE, and wanted to finally upgrade to 2.2.5, guess what... Ain't no such tag. You want RELENG_2_2 to follow the branch or RELENG_2_2_5_RELEASE if you want a static snapshot of just the release. Jordan
